Ex-Arsenal man: Selling Bellerin would be a ‘good bit of business’

Former Arsenal striker Kevin Campbell thinks it would be a “good bit of business” from the club if they sold Hector Bellerin to Barcelona.
Like the Gunners, the Spanish defender’s performances have been poor for most of the season and he’s come under criticism from pundits and fans.
Despite that, Bellerin has been linked with a move away from the Emirates Stadium with Barcelona reportedly interested in taking him to the Camp Nou.

The Spain international played well as Arsenal won their first Premier League match since November 1 on Saturday, beating Chelsea 3-1, but Campbell still thinks the club should sell him.
“Bellerin, by his own admission, has not been ripping trees up. He was getting exposed at times,” Campbell told Football Insider. “Maitland-Niles really sured up the right-hand side when he came in earlier this month. The performances were a lot more solid, especially on that right-hand side.
“There is a question to be asked of Bellerin and a lot of fans are asking it. Will the club sell him?
“There is rumours of Barcelona’s interest. It is his boyhood club, the club he loves and maybe that would be a good bit of business.”
